Weinstadt, Deutschland - aalen (ots)-In the last few days there have been several incidents in the Rems-Murr district that attracted the attention of the police. Burglaries, accidents and property damage shape the current situation in this region.
in Waiblingen there was an abortion in which an unknown perpetrator entered a house on Galgenberg between Saturday afternoon and Sunday evening. The premises were searched here, with an amount of around 2,500 euros being stolen. Notes on the burglar or suspicious vehicles are requested to the Waiblingen police station on 07151/950422
accident flees keep police in breath
Another problem is the increasing number of accidental escape. In Weinstadt, a Renault Kangoo in Schweizerbachstrasse was damaged between Friday and Saturday, the cause of around 500 euros left. A BMW was also damaged in Waiblingen, on the water tower, when he parked there between Wednesday and Sunday. Here the damage amounts to a proud 2,000 euros.
A particularly brazen incident occurred on the K 1849 between Leutenbach and Bittenfeld when an unknown driver did not adequately remove to the right and collided with the external mirror of an oncoming BMW, which belonged to a 42-year-old. The polluter simply continued and also left several hundred euros.

alcohol at the wheel leads to incidents
Another worrying topic is alcohol -related traffic accidents. In Weinstadt there was an incident on Friday evening at 11:15 p.m. when a 26-year-old VW driver joined a parked Dacia. With over two per thousand alcohol in the blood, he not only had to give up his driver's license, but also to endure a blood sample. The property damage was estimated at around 7,000 euros.
In another incident in Waiblingen, on Saturday evening at 7:20 p.m., a 36-year-old Opel driver came into play with almost three per thousand. She rose to a VW controlled by a 42-year-old woman. Fortunately, the property damage remained low, but this incident also led to the blood sample and the retention of the driving license of the causer.
